Abstract

Abstract We consider nonlinear stochastic wave equations driven by time-space white noise. The existence of solutions is proved by the method of successive approximations. Next we apply Newton’s method. The main result concerning its first-order convergence is based on Cairoli’s maximal inequalities for two-parameter martingales. Moreover, a second-order convergence in a probabilistic sense is demonstrated.
